Within our drama club, every student can find a place to contribute. From technical jobs, such as set building and painting, to lighting and sound, our students take leadership roles within the production. They work together in teams to learn new skills and help create mentoring relationships.
Students who participate in the drama club come from grades 6-11 and from diverse backgrounds.
They join our production with a range of varying experiences, and the older drama club members help to mentor the younger ones. Through our practices they learn the skills necessary for running the production themselves. Students take up leadership roles within every area of the play’s production. They learn to manage the backstage organization. They learn how to run the lighting system. They take up the leadership of the production. Despite our tight budget, students learn valuable lessons!

One of the areas in which my students need additional resources is technical theatre. Although we teach the elements of design in our theatre classes, we need additional supplies in order to truly practice technical work, instead of just studying it. Our students have won awards at festival for lighting and costuming, but we need resources to continue to further educate our student theatre designers and technicians.
Students take up leadership roles in every element of technical theatre, from setting up and designing lights and sound to creating costumes and set pieces.
These tools will give students the resources they need for another season of growth in the area of technical theatre!
Because our current backstage communication system needs improvements and updates, a new set of wireless intercoms will be a big help! It is challenging to have clear and precise communication when the walkie talkies do not work consistently! We have recently acquired a new lighting board, and this monitor will be a part of our programmed lighting system. These text books will be great resources for us as we continue to research technical theatre and learn new information.
Because our program is self-funded, we need the help of our incredible community to help our Drama Club and Theatre Program. These items will go a long way in giving our students the tools they need to advance in their technical skills and to aid them in the storytelling of theatre.
